This two day program, led by passionate educators from across the APLS community, expands on APLS GIC course content with an emphasis on practical techniques. 

Alongside the APLS Education support team, the facilitators supporting this program include: Susan Adams, Victor Lee, Jacquie Schutz, Jim Flynn, Alex Thorburn, Olwen Gilbert and Jennie Martin.

The Educational Skills Development Course (ESDC) course has been designed to support APLS instructors to enhance their skills as facilitators of learning. The focus during this two day course will be on the teaching modes of scenario teaching, discussion groups, skills teaching and on feedback techniques. Participants will be given opportunities to develop skills as facilitators through discussion, practice and peer-to-peer learning.

Pre-course

The program comprises 6-8 hours of pre-course preparation. This includes: the 4e Pocket Guide to Teaching for Clinical Instructors (provided), recommended reading, online videos and materials for you to prepare for facilitation of a small group discussion group, skills station and scenario teaching session.

 

During the course

Plenary sessions will be aimed at enhancing your pre-course reading and clarifying expectations of you in the small group practice sessions. Facilitation is a dynamic process, so the priority of the program is to give you opportunities to practice.

During the small group practice sessions, all attendees will rotate through roles of:

  • Role-playing a realistic candidate
  • Facilitating the teaching session (skills, scenario teaching and discussion group)
  • Leading the learning conversation for the facilitator and participants

 

Course Outcomes

It is anticipated that this interactive program will provide you with:

  • Knowledge of current medical education practices
  • Development of your skills for facilitating small group learning
  • Measures to assess the effectiveness of teaching and learning
